Pinellas County Convention and Visitors Bureau (CVB) has awarded a contract for convention and event fulfillment services to Concepts Marketing Solutions Inc. - Government Buyer: - Pinellas County, Convention and Visitors Bureau (CVB) - Contracting office: Pinellas County Purchasing Department, Clearwater, FL - Awarded Vendor: - Concepts Marketing Solutions Inc. - Scope of Services: - Storage, packing, and shipping of collateral materials (e.g., plastic trade show bags, area guides, maps, brochures) - Handling 7-12 orders per week, each order typically 3-4 boxes averaging 40 lbs - Local and national shipping, with local deliveries via Scriptfleet courier and economical tracked shipping for out-of-county orders - Dry storage space, forklift unloading, and recycling of outdated materials - Inventory management and replenishment coordination with publishers and CVB - Notable Requirements: - Vendor must be located within Pinellas County - Timely delivery (3-5 days) and ability to handle fluctuating order volumes - Use of specific courier and shipping methods as directed by CVB - Contract Value and Term: - Estimated value: $200,000 over 60 months (approx. $14,640 per year) - Lump sum monthly service fee plus reimbursement for actual shipping costs - No specific OEMs or part numbers are involved; the procurement is for fulfillment services only.
Description
Pinellas County is soliciting bids for convention and event fulfillment services for its Convention and Visitors Bureau (CVB). The contract involves storage, fulfillment, and shipping of collateral materials such as trade show bags, area guides, maps, and brochures both locally and nationally. The vendor must be located within Pinellas County and capable of handling fluctuating weekly orders with timely delivery. The contract term is from November 1, 2018, to October 31, 2026, with an estimated award amount of $200,000.
